Four explosions heard in Kyiv

Four explosions were heard in Kyiv on Sunday as air raid sirens sounded across Ukraine, according to CMG reporters.

Ukrainian news agency UNIAN said one person has died as a result of the "Russian missile attack."

Emergency services said a nine-story residential building had been partially damaged in the attack.

Kyiv's mayor, Vitali Klitschko, said residents are being rescued and evacuated from two buildings. 

"There are people under the rubble," Klitschko said on the Telegram messaging app. He said several people had already been hospitalized.

Local broadcaster Ukraine 24 claimed that 14 missiles were fired in the region.

Russia has not responded to the claims.
